📅  最后修改于: 2023-12-03 15:25:14.568000             🧑  作者: Mango
在数据分析和处理中,经常需要将处理后的数据存储在本地。 Excel 是最常用的电子表格软件之一,很多人都可以方便地阅读和使用它。在 Python 中,我们可以使用 Pandas 来处理数据,并将其导出为 Excel 文件。
在开始使用 Pandas 导出数据之前,需要确保已经安装了 Pandas 库。可以通过以下命令安装 Pandas:
pip install pandas
Pandas 使用 to_excel
函数来将数据导出为 Excel 文件。该函数的语法如下:
df.to_excel(excel_writer, sheet_name='Sheet1',**kwargs)
其中,excel_writer
是文件名或已经打开的文件对象,用于保存 Excel 数据。sheet_name
是 Excel 工作表的名称,可以是字符串或整数。kwargs
包含其他的可选参数,如格式设置等。
以下是一个示例代码,将 Pandas 数据框导出为一个 Excel 文件:
import pandas as pd
data = {'姓名': ['张三', '李四', '王五', '赵六'], '年龄': [23, 32, 45, 19], '性别': ['男', '女', '男', '女']}
df = pd.DataFrame(data)
with pd.ExcelWriter('人员名单.xlsx') as writer:
df.to_excel(writer, sheet_name='Sheet1', index=False)
在此示例中,我们将一个包含姓名、年龄和性别的数据字典转换为 Pandas 数据框。然后,我们使用 with
语句和 ExcelWriter
对象将数据框导出为一个名为“人员名单.xlsx”的 Excel 文件。在导出数据时,我们还指定了工作表的名称“Sheet1”,并将索引列禁用。
使用 Pandas 导出数据为 Excel 文件非常简单。只需使用 to_excel
函数并指定文件名,就可以将 Pandas 数据框保存为一个 Excel 文件。通过学习这个简单的方法,您可以轻松地将处理后的数据导出为 Excel 文件,以便于保存和共享。